A decagram is 10 grams, so first lets convert the decagrams to grams and then after we'll change to kilograms.
If 1 decagram equals 10 grams, then 2500 decagrams is equal to:
2500*10 = 25000 grams
Now, 1 kilogram equals 1000 grams so 25000 grams equals:
25000/1000 = 25 kg
therefore, 2500 decagrams equals 25 kg
